Ibrahim Kamil Al-Windawi ({{langx|ar| إبراهيم كامل الونداوي }}; born 9 September 1988) is an Iraqi footballer who last played as a midfielder for Al-Minaa. He was part of the Iraq national football team in the 2014 World Cup qualification. He was coached by the Brazilian coach Zico.{{Citation needed|date=March 2024}}
